Genesis Communications is selling Brokered 1470 WMGG Egypt Lake/Tampa FL to Neal Ardman’s NIA Broadcasting for $350,000 where it will become a sister station to Classic Hip-Hop 1150 WTMP Egypt Lake and Regional Mexican “96.1 La Mexicana” WTMP-FM Dade City. As part of the deal NIA has begun operating the station via Time Brokerage Agreement and has flipped it to a simulcast of WTMP-FM.
Tron Dinh Do’s Intelli LLC is converting its LMA of Astor Broadcasting’s 1510 KSPA Ontario/Riverside CA into a purchase for $1.35 million. KSPA carries Intelli’s Vietnamese “Vien Thao Radio“.
Future Modulation Broadcasting sells AC “My 102.1” KQMY Paia HI to Hochman Hawaii Four for $1,000. Future Modulation acquired the station from Educational Media Foundation in 2017 in a multi-station swap.
American Family Association sells 88.1 KGLL Gillette WY to Real Presence Radio for $50,000.
Family Worship Center Church purchases Southern Gospel 89.5 WGSG Mayo FL from True Concepts of Levy County Inc. for $175,000.
Translator Sales
Fred Baker sells 94.3 K232AV Boonville AR to Community Radio Inc. for $35,000. K232AV is licensed to rebroadcast Pearson Broadcasting of Mena’s Sports “ESPN Arkansas” 96.3 KTTG Mena.
